Symbolism and Cultural Significance
Dolphins are universally recognized as symbols of intelligence, playfulness, and freedom. In many cultures, they represent guidance, protection, and a connection to the ocean’s spiritual energy. The inclusion of a mother and baby dolphin adds a layer of meaning, symbolizing family, nurturing, and the continuation of life. This symbolic tattoo is a beautiful expression of love for the ocean and its creatures.
